So I have been hearing about this for the last few hours now, SI being the main source.
Apparently Lewis is being accused of using deer antler velvet extract to help speed up his recovery from his torn tricep earlier this season. Apparently the extract contains IGF-1, which is on the NFL banned substance list.
The story gets stranger by the minute, but the accuser claims have recorded phone calls in which Lewis is asking how to use it, etc. Lewis did come back very quickly from an injury that was supposed to end his season when it first happened.
